Premier League giants implement sophisticated cybersecurity measures to combat industrial-scale bot operations targeting match tickets
The Growing Bot Threat
Professional football’s most prestigious clubs are facing an unprecedented digital assault from sophisticated automated systems designed to monopolize ticket sales. Recent investigations by BBC Sport reveal that automated bots and fraudulent account networks have evolved into massive commercial operations, forcing clubs to deploy advanced technological countermeasures.
The scale of this digital ticket fraud has reached alarming proportions, with security experts identifying coordinated attacks that leverage cutting-edge bot technology, proxy networks, and artificial intelligence to circumvent traditional security protocols. Research indicates that bots now account for more than half of all internet traffic, highlighting the broader scope of automated threats across digital platforms.
Massive Account Termination Operations
Three of England’s most prominent football institutions have revealed staggering statistics about their ongoing battle against ticket fraud:
Liverpool FC’s Digital Crackdown:
The Merseyside club disclosed that its cybersecurity team eliminated approximately 145,000 fraudulent accounts over a 24-month period. Additionally, the club issued 1,114 permanent exclusions during the previous season alone, representing one of the most aggressive anti-fraud campaigns in sports history.
Arsenal’s Comprehensive Response:
The North London club reported canceling nearly 74,000 suspicious accounts within a single season, while simultaneously revoking more than 7,000 membership privileges for individuals connected to scalping operations.
Chelsea’s Bot Blocking Success:
Stamford Bridge officials revealed they successfully intercepted over 350,000 automated purchase attempts, demonstrating the industrial scale of bot-driven ticket acquisition efforts.
Technological Arms Race
Advanced Bot Operations
Investigators have uncovered sophisticated fraud networks employing:
- Multi-layered proxy systems that mask geographic locations
- Artificial intelligence algorithms that mimic human browsing patterns
- Disposable communication devices to create untraceable digital identities
- Automated account generation capable of creating thousands of profiles simultaneously
Club Defense Strategies
In response, football clubs are implementing:
- Multi-factor authentication protocols requiring multiple verification steps
- Encrypted barcode technology that changes dynamically to prevent duplication
- Behavioral analysis software that identifies non-human purchasing patterns
- Real-time IP monitoring to detect suspicious geographic clustering
The Economics of Digital Scalping
Research indicates that overseas reselling platforms have transformed ticket scalping into a billion-pound industry. These operations purchase tickets at face value through fraudulent means, then resell them at markup rates often exceeding 500% of original prices.
The global nature of these operations complicates enforcement, as many reselling platforms operate from jurisdictions with limited cooperation agreements with UK authorities.
Social Media Exploitation
Liverpool’s investigation uncovered 162 social media groups with combined membership exceeding one million users, all dedicated to facilitating illegal ticket transactions. These platforms serve as sophisticated marketplaces where scalpers coordinate purchasing strategies and distribute tickets to international buyers.
The clubs have successfully petitioned social media platforms to remove these groups, though new communities frequently emerge using encrypted messaging applications and private networks.
Law Enforcement Challenges
Despite the massive scale of ticket fraud, enforcement remains limited. Official statistics show only 12 arrests for ticket touting across England’s top six football divisions during the previous season, highlighting the gap between the problem’s magnitude and regulatory response.
Legal experts suggest that current legislation struggles to address the technological sophistication of modern scalping operations, particularly those operating across international borders.
Industry-Wide Response
The Premier League has issued comprehensive warnings to supporters about the risks of purchasing tickets through unauthorized channels, including:
- Financial fraud risk from non-existent tickets
- Security vulnerabilities at stadium entrances
- Legal consequences for unknowing participation in scalping networks
Technology Integration Success
Early results from enhanced security measures show promising outcomes:
- 98% reduction in successful bot purchases at participating clubs
- Significant decrease in ticket prices on secondary markets
- Improved fan satisfaction due to increased availability for legitimate supporters
Future Security Measures
Clubs are exploring additional technological solutions including:
- Blockchain-based ticket verification systems
- Biometric authentication for high-demand matches
- Machine learning algorithms that adapt to evolving bot tactics
- Industry-wide data sharing to identify repeat offenders
